Course Content

• Introduction to Carbon Fiber Composites: Material Properties and Selection
• Manufacturing Processes for Carbon Fiber Aerospace Components: Autoclave Curing, Resin Transfer Molding (RTM), and more
• Mechanical Testing and Characterization of Carbon Fiber Composites: Tensile, Fatigue, and Impact Testing
• Design and Analysis of Carbon Fiber Aerospace Structures: Finite Element Analysis (FEA) and structural optimization
• Failure Mechanisms and Damage Tolerance in Carbon Fiber Composites
• Advanced Composites and Nanomaterials in Aerospace Applications
• Joining and Repair of Carbon Fiber Composites: Adhesive bonding, mechanical fastening
• Non-Destructive Testing (NDT) of Carbon Fiber Composites: Ultrasonic inspection, radiography
• Sustainability and Life Cycle Assessment of Carbon Fiber Composites in Aerospace
• Regulations and Standards for Carbon Fiber Composites in Aerospace Manufacturing

Career path

Career Role Description
Aerospace Composite Technician (Carbon Fiber) Hands-on role involving the fabrication, repair, and inspection of carbon fiber components for aircraft and spacecraft. Requires strong knowledge of composite materials and manufacturing processes.
Carbon Fiber Design Engineer Focuses on the design and analysis of carbon fiber structures for optimal strength, weight, and performance. Proficient in CAD software and composite material modeling.
Composite Materials Specialist Expert in material selection, testing, and characterization of various composite materials, including carbon fiber. Plays a vital role in quality control and material development.
Aircraft Maintenance Engineer (Carbon Fiber) Specializes in the maintenance and repair of aircraft structures incorporating carbon fiber composites. Deep understanding of aircraft maintenance regulations and procedures is essential.
